Hope this is the right alias; NVIDIA has (relatively recently) added an 
application profile engine to their driver. They ship a default settings 
database with each driver release that contains workaround for known 
buggy application and other tweaks. For instance, not having it makes 
Gnome3 unusable because older versions of cogl rely on non-conformant 
behavior for framebuffer blits, which the profiles database knows about 
and accounts for.

That settings database doesn't appear to currently be packaged or 
installed by any of the binary packages in nvidia-graphics-driver, 
unless I'm overlooking something, which is very possible. Is it 
something you guys are already looking into?
